Maintenance Planner

BASF · Greenville, OH · 3 wk ago
ProductFull-time

About the role

We are seeking a professional to join our team. In this role, you will be responsible for planning and scheduling of maintenance, repair, and construction work to ensure 24/7 operation of the chemical manufacturing process. This position will also serve as a backup to the maintenance supervisor at various times throughout the year.

Responsibilities

  • Troubleshooting operations problems
  • Order repair parts
  • Manage the work order backlog
  • Perform long-range and short-term planning of in-house and contractor labor
  • Cost estimating
  • Ensure all critical spare parts and materials are in inventory
  • Execute expedited repairs efficiently
  • Support and adhere to environmental, health, safety, and security principles
  • Use Total Productive Maintenance techniques
  • Track key performance indicators and maintain equipment histories
  • Analyze cost trends
  • Coordinate with procurement department, in-house and contractor labor, suppliers, and technical representatives
  • Use SAP for maintenance work orders and procurement processes
  • Maintain critical SAP data such as functional locations, material masters, and maintenance plans
  • Plan and schedule annual turnarounds of various production plants
  • Coordinate all resources for repair parts, contract labor, rental equipment, etc.

Requirements

  • High School Diploma/GED required; advanced degree preferred
  • Experience with chemical plant production equipment highly preferred
  • At least 3+ years related expertise using SAP PM and MM
  • In-depth knowledge of maintenance systems and equipment, planning, and scheduling
  • Ability to read piping & instrumentation diagrams, engineering specifications, engineering drawings, wiring diagrams, loop diagrams, and vendor-supplied technical information
  • SAP knowledge and understanding required. MSProject, and Avetta software preferred
  • Possess a good working knowledge of all crafts and a solid understanding of MPI
  • Deal effectively with the unknown and unexpected

Qualifications

  • Expertise in multiple crafts (mechanical, I/E, scaffolding, rigging, excavation)
  • Good working knowledge of all crafts and a solid understanding of MPI
  • Ability to handle non-routine and emergency activities

Skills

  • Knowledge of OSHA PSM regulations, ASME codes, and API codes
  • Continuous improvement competency
  • Effective communication and coordination skills
